Assessing Your Home's Solar Potential
Before diving into solar panel installation, you need to evaluate your home's solar capacity. Beginning by examining your roof covering's positioning and incline; south-facing roofs normally catch one of the most sunshine.
Seek any type of blockages, like trees or tall structures, that could cast shadows on your panels. These can significantly reduce power manufacturing. Consider your regional climate too; sunny locations yield better outcomes than constantly over cast areas.
Next off, examine your power requirements and use patterns to figure out how many panels you'll require. You could also want to make use of on the internet solar calculators or talk to a specialist to obtain a more clear photo.

Panel Effectiveness Scores
As you discover the world of solar panels, understanding panel effectiveness ratings is crucial for making a notified decision. These ratings suggest just how effectively a panel transforms sunlight right into useful electrical energy. The higher the effectiveness, the a lot more energy you'll produce from a smaller room. The majority of property panels range from 15% to 22% performance.
When picking your panels, consider your power demands and readily available roof covering space. If you have limited area, opting for higher-efficiency panels could be advantageous. However, if you have ample roof covering location, lower-efficiency panels might be adequate.
Installation Kind Options
Picking the right installment kind for solar panels can substantially influence your system's performance and performance. You'll usually run into 2 main choices: roof-mounted and ground-mounted systems.
Roof-mounted panels are frequently the go-to choice for house owners, as they utilize existing room and can be less expensive to install. Nevertheless, if your roof isn't appropriate-- maybe as a result of shading or structural problems-- ground-mounted systems may be the better option.
They allow for optimal positioning, making best use of sunshine direct exposure. Additionally, you can readjust their angle to enhance effectiveness.
